Easter Sunday Service at Windsor Castle:

One of the most important events of Easter for the British Royal Family is the Easter Sunday service at St George's Chapel, Windsor Castle. This chapel has been a significant place for the royals, as many of them have been baptized, married, and buried here. This year, the service will be held in a more intimate setting due to the ongoing pandemic, but it will still be a significant event for the royals.

The King and the Queen Consort will attend the service, along with other members of the royal family. They will all be dressed in their finest attire and will be greeted by members of the public as they arrive. The service will be conducted by the Dean of Windsor, and it will include hymns, prayers, and a sermon.
